Beef Update

IFA Livestock Chair Declan Hanrahan has hit out at the behaviour of meat factories in dropping prices for the most expensive cattle to produce when our key export markets are strong. EU prices have now surged past ours, something that hasn’t happened since the end of 2024. This reflects the strength of demand for beef in a market that took half of our exports in 2025 and continues to be a key outlet. EU beef prices have risen over 65c/kg since last June. Our prices over the same period have dropped almost 30c/kg, representing a turnaround of almost €1/kg. In the outlets for 90% of our exports, prices are almost 30c/kg above ours as EU and UK beef prices align. Both these high value markets have reduced production, so they need more imports. Winter finishers will not take this unacceptable behaviour lying down. Farmers have made huge investments in buying stock and finishing them for factories at the most expensive time of year, only to find themselves faced with weak selling and opportunism from factories. He said factories need to urgently reassess their behaviour of the last few weeks, stand strong and return viable prices to farmers or there will be longer term repercussions for the sector.

Beef Price Update 12/03/2026

Base Steer €6.80/7.10kg. Heifers €6.90/7.05kg. Higher deals for larger and specialist lots. Y Bulls R/U €7.00/7.30Kg. Cows €6.20/6.80kg.

Sheep Update

IFA Sheep Chairman Adrian Gallagher said hogget prices push on further as factories scramble for supplies. He said demand for sheepmeat has intensified in the past week with prices rising by up to 40c/kg. Supplies of suitable finished hoggets are extremely tight on the ground as weekly throughput continues to fall. Total hogget throughput is back over 24,000 head to date in 2026. He said the mart trade has also strengthened for finished lambs with prices exceeding factory quotes in almost every case. Factory prices for hoggets this week range from €8.30kg to €8.50kg on weights to 23kg. Cull ewes have also increased and are making from €4.60kg to €5.00. Adrian Gallagher said farmers should sell hard and be mindful of the mart outlet which remains a real credible alternative to sellers at present.

Lamb Price Update 12/03/2026

Hoggets €8.30/8.50kg. Weights to 23kg. Higher deals groups/larger lots. Ewes €4.40/5.00/kg.
